I. Core Matching: Impedance and Gain Are Key to Tube Amplifier Matching
1. Impedance Matching (The First Rule of Tube Amplifiers)
The output impedance of tube preamplifiers is generally higher than that of solid-state amplifiers; improper matching can easily lead to high-frequency attenuation, a muffled sound, and insufficient dynamics.
Gold standard: The power amplifier’s input impedance should be ≥ 10 times the preamplifier’s output impedance (20 times is optimal).

2. Gain Matching (Avoiding Distortion, Balancing Dynamics)
Gain determines the degree of signal amplification. Tube systems require a reserve of dynamic headroom to prevent clipping distortion at high volumes.
Standard sources (CD/DAC/mobile phones): A preamp with standard gain of 10–20dB is sufficient, matching the input sensitivity (350–380mV) of integrated amplifiers such as the Oilily A88 MK and A300B MK.
Vinyl turntables (MM/MC): A preamplifier with a phono stage and high gain of 60–70 dB is essential to compensate for the weak vinyl signal and prevent background noise from becoming prominent.
Vacuum Tube Amplifier Gain Principle: The preamplifier should provide 60–70% of the gain, whilst the power amplifier provides 30–40%, leaving a dynamic headroom of ≥6dB. III. Interface and Functionality: Designed to Meet the Practical Needs of Oilily Tube Amplifiers
1. Input Interfaces: Compatible with various audio sources and multiple devices
RCA Single-ended: Suitable for short-range connections in the home (≤2 metres); simple, reliable and good value for money; compatible with the RCA input terminals on Oilily tube amplifiers.
XLR Balanced: Preferred for longer cables (>2 metres) or when low noise is a priority; offers strong interference resistance and purer signal transmission, compatible with the balanced inputs of high-end models such as the A88 MK.
Phono Input (MM/MC): Essential for vinyl enthusiasts. Choose a preamp with MM (47kΩ) or MC (100Ω–1kΩ) phono stages to connect directly to a turntable without the need for additional adapters.

V. Final Tips: A Guide to Avoiding Pitfalls in Tube Amplifier Matching
Tube Pairing: Tubes in the preamp must be replaced and used in matched pairs (e.g., KT88/EL34 pairs, 300B pairs) to avoid tonal imbalance.
Cable Selection: Use high-quality shielded cables, no longer than 2 metres, and avoid bundling them with power cables to minimise interference; silver-plated or oxygen-free copper signal cables are recommended for tube amplifier systems.
Power-up Sequence: Switch on the preamplifier first; allow it to warm up for 30 seconds before switching on the power amplifier. The shutdown sequence is the reverse, to prevent inrush current from damaging the tubes.
